I have tried the VBoost both ways, and unfortunately, had the rear intake cam split in two pieces which I am sure you read about, now fixed of-course, and when I re-installed my fresh valve-job engine and new (used) intake cam (thank-god for parts engines for spares readily-available!) I re-plugged the VBoost motor, so I have it working again, instead of open all the time.
Frankly, when I went for a ride yesterday after installing my Jap big-bore sportbike (canister -only) exhaust onto my UFO headers, I didn't really notice the 'surge' I get w/the stock exhaust. The VBoost was active. I might need to play-around a bit to see the effects of plugged-in vs. unplugged VBoost. When I was using the full UFO Dragstar 4/1 w/either the 'balogna-cut' "muffler" or the UFO megaphone instead, I did have a distinct sensation of the VBoost working. I tried it w/the full UFO & unplugged VBoost, but decided I liked the throttle response better w/it working. It also seemed like it started better (easier) w/the VBoost working, though I am not sure if that was just some subjective issue. It didn't take as-long to crank & start. You barely needed to hit the starter, but then again, I have a "Vanity Battery!" Li-ion, you know!:biglaugh: